Your Guide to FHA Loans in Virginia
Virginia homebuyers looking for financing options often consider FHA loans. These government-backed loans offer competitive interest rates and flexible lending criteria, making them a popular choice for first-time buyers or those with less-than-perfect credit.
An FHA loan is insured by the Federal Housing Administration FHA Loan Virginia (FHA), which reduces risk for lenders. This allows lenders to offer more affordable terms compared to conventional loans.
To qualify for an FHA loan in Virginia, buyers must meet certain criteria. These typically include a minimum credit score, debt-to-income ratio (DTI), and down payment percentage.
Virginia's real estate market can be competitive, so having a clear understanding of the FHA loan process is crucial. Working with an experienced lender who specializes in FHA loans can support you through each step, from application to closing.
Remember that while FHA loans offer advantages, they also come with certain fees. These include an upfront mortgage insurance premium (UFMIP) and an annual mortgage insurance premium (MIP).
Before making a decision, it's important to research the various FHA loan programs available in Virginia and compare interest rates, terms, and fees from different lenders.

Benefits of an FHA Loan for First-Time Homebuyers in Virginia
FHA loans offer numerous benefits to first-time homebuyers navigating the competitive Virginia real estate market. These government-backed loans necessitate lower down payments compared to conventional mortgages, making homeownership more attainable for those with limited savings.
Furthermore, FHA loans are known for their relaxed credit score requirements, offering opportunities to first-time buyers who may not met the stricter criteria of conventional lenders. This availability can be especially helpful for individuals constructing their credit history.
One benefit of FHA loans is that they often have lower closing costs compared to other loan types, helping buyers minimize upfront expenses. This can be a significant factor for first-time homebuyers who are already facing the expenses associated with purchasing a home.
Finally, FHA loans offer security to lenders through mortgage insurance premiums (MIP), which compensate potential losses. This mitigates lender risk and allows them to offer more lenient loan terms to borrowers, ultimately making homeownership a more feasible goal for first-time buyers in Virginia.
